The Army Historical Foundation is working in a public/private partnership with the U. S. Army on a capital campaign for the National Museum of the U.S. Army.

The Director of Major Gifts serves as a front-line fundraiser and member of AHF’s fundraising team.  Primary duties include establishing and managing effective relationships with donor prospects and existing donors, and assisting in building a successful fundraising program.

The Director of Major Gifts, under the supervision of the Senior Director of Development, will identify and qualify potential major donors, and design and implement successful cultivation and solicitation strategies.  This position will solicit prospects, and steward existing donors, and is expected to conduct 10-15 donor visits per month and manage a portfolio of at least 100 prospects.
